Common Chamberlain Garage Door Problems We Solve in Hacienda Heights
- Gear and sprocket failure in chain-drive models (B1381, HD750WF). Hacienda Heights’ cut-and-fill hillside lots generate fine, powdery dust that infiltrates gear housings. We’ve replaced dozens of dry, cracked gear packs on homes near Colima Road where the grading exposed raw soil for decades. The grinding sound is unmistakable, and the fix is a new OEM gear assembly, usually done in under two hours.
- MyQ connectivity drops on smart models (B2202, B2211T). The Puente Hills terrain and dense hillside construction create Wi-Fi dead zones that Chamberlain’s app can’t always navigate. We map signal strength at the opener location, then recommend either a Wi-Fi extender positioned in the garage or a hardwired wall-button bypass for homeowners who need reliable remote access.
- Travel limit sensor drift on belt-drive units (B4615T, B970). Uneven garage floors in 1960s tract homes, where hillside pads settled over 50-plus years, throw off the baseline calibration. The door reverses randomly or doesn’t fully seal. We recalibrate limits, then check whether the floor slope has worsened enough to need track shimming.
- Capacitor failure in Power Drive series (PD612, PD712). South-facing hillside garages in Hacienda Heights hit interior temperatures above 120°F during summer heatwaves. That thermal cycling degrades capacitors fast. We see this most on homes above Glenmark Drive, where afternoon sun bakes the garage wall for six hours straight.
- Weatherstripping and bottom seal deterioration. Santa Ana winds channeling through the Puente Hills corridor tear through vinyl seals in two to three years, not the five you’d expect inland. For Chamberlain-equipped garages, this means the door’s safety sensors get exposed to dust and debris, causing false obstruction readings. We replace seals with heavy-duty EPDM rubber that outlasts OEM vinyl.
Chamberlain Service in Hacienda Heights: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Hacienda Heights is unincorporated LA County territory, which means every permit for structural garage door work, spring replacement, or track modification routes through LA County Building and Safety, not a city office. Their inspection criteria for seismic reinforcement, specifically diagonal bracing on tracks and anchored jamb brackets, are stricter than what Chamberlain repair in La Puente or West Covina require. Contractors who work those cities routinely get red-tagged here because they don’t brace for hillside lateral loads. For Chamberlain owners, this matters when you’re upgrading from an old chain drive to a modern belt unit, the new opener’s mounting bracket often needs reinforcement that triggers permit requirements. We handle the LA County submittal, know the inspector by name, and spec the hardware so it passes the first time. Chamberlain Models & Products We Service in Hacienda Heights
We train on the full Chamberlain residential line and stock parts for same-day repair on these model families:
- 1/2 HP Chain Drive: B1381, HD750WF — budget workhorses common in original 1960s Hacienda Heights tract homes
- 3/4 HP Belt Drive: B4615T, B970 — quieter operation, popular with homeowners upgrading near Hacienda Boulevard
- 1.25 HP MyQ Smart: B2202, B2211T — Wi-Fi enabled, but signal challenges in hillside terrain require our pre-install site survey
- Power Drive: PD612, PD712 — discontinued but still running in hundreds of local garages; we rebuild rather than replace when it makes sense
For safety-critical components, circuit boards, gear assemblies, travel modules, we use OEM Chamberlain parts. For rollers, springs, and weatherstripping, we source heavy-duty aftermarket equivalents that outperform originals in Hacienda Heights’ wind and UV exposure. Direct afternoon sun on west- and south-facing Hacienda Heights garages can blind Chamberlain’s infrared sensors, especially on homes above Glenmark Drive. The blinking LED means the beam is interrupted, either by misalignment, debris, or solar interference. We realign sensors, clean housings, and can install sun shields or reposition brackets if your garage orientation makes this a recurring issue. This is a 20-minute fix in most cases.
